Job Description:
We are seeking a dedicated and hardworking Structural Steel Shop Laborer to join our team. The ideal candidate will be responsible for assisting in the fabrication of structural steel components. This is an excellent opportunity for individuals who are looking to gain experience in the steel industry.
Key Responsibilities:
- Assist with the preparation and cleaning of materials for steel fabrication.
- Load and unload materials, tools, and equipment within the shop.
- Operate various hand tools and power tools safely and efficiently.
- Support welders, fabricators, and machine operators during the production process.
- Move materials and finished products to designated areas within the shop or yard.
- Maintain a clean, safe, and organized work environment.
- Follow safety guidelines and protocols to prevent accidents and injuries.
- Perform general labor tasks as needed in the shop and on-site.
Qualifications:
- High school diploma or equivalent preferred.
- Previous experience in a construction, steel, or fabrication environment is a plus, but not required.
- Ability to work in a physically demanding environment, including lifting heavy materials.
- Basic knowledge of hand and power tools.
- Strong attention to detail and safety-conscious mindset.
- Ability to follow instructions and work well within a team.
- Reliable transportation to and from the job site.
- Proficient in operating Forklift is a plus.
Physical Requirements:
- Ability to lift up to 50 lbs.
- Ability to stand, walk, bend, and squat for extended periods.
- Able to work with materials and machinery, following all safety protocols.
